Overview Lulicozo 1% Cream
Dermafung 1% Cream, an antifungal medication, effectively combats various skin fungal infections including athlete's foot, tinea cruris, candidiasis, tinea corporis, and dry, scaling skin. Its mechanism involves eliminating the causative fungi. Apply Dermafung 1% Cream precisely as directed by your physician; exceeding the prescribed dose or frequency won't hasten recovery and may heighten adverse effects. Most skin infections resolve within 2-4 weeks. Report any lack of improvement to your doctor. Maintaining cleanliness and dryness of the affected area, along with handwashing before and after application, enhances efficacy. For athlete's foot, ensure thorough sock/stocking cleaning and daily shoe changes when feasible. Common side effects—burning, irritation, itching, redness, and dryness at the application site—are usually transient. Persistent or bothersome side effects warrant medical consultation. Seek immediate medical help for allergic reactions (rash, lip/throat/facial swelling, breathing/swallowing difficulties, nausea). Avoid eye contact; rinse with water and seek medical attention if contact occurs. While unlikely, inform your physician about concurrent medications (oral or injectable), especially recent steroid use or prior antifungal allergies.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should consult their doctor before using this cream.

How Lulicozo 1% Cream works:
Dermafung 1% cream is an antifungal treatment for cutaneous fungal infections. Its mechanism involves disrupting the fungal cell membrane, thereby eliminating the infection and alleviating associated skin discomfort, itching, and inflammation.

What if you forget to take Lulicozo 1% Cream :
Should you forget a Lulicozo 1% Cream application, apply it promptly. However, if your next scheduled application is imminent, omit the missed one and resume your usual dosing regimen. Never apply a double dose.
